Software Architecture in Practice by Len Bass, Paul Clements, Rick Kazman

Software Architecture in Practice



Download eBook




Software Architecture in Practice Len Bass, Paul Clements, Rick Kazman ebook
Publisher: Addison-Wesley Professional
Page: 493
Format: pdf
ISBN: 0321154959, 9780321154958


Fairbanks in his book says: “In practice, you will often find it difficult to differentiate architecture from detailed design”. It should be noted, that my intention is not to advocate a Solutions Architecture as another tedious task in the software development process, but to provide a software architecture practice that is. A couple of years ago we called someone programming software applications a programmer, now such a person is called a Solution Architect. Software Architecture in Practice ( http://tinyurl.com/qm2dl ) by Bass, Clements, Kazman introduces software architecture and also reveals in-depth perspectives. I found this very interesting presentation (from 2008) about the eBay architectural design, done by Randy Shoup, who is a distinguished architect at eBay. Being a software architect a lot of your work has to do with best practices.It is best practices that you. Of course, I did not read all the books about software Architecture available in the market, but I read two great books, which I recommend ( mentioned on footnotes below), but neither of them, IMHO, are clear when try to differentiate one from the other. In my opinion, this architecture guide not only focus on the .NET platform and is a really good cookbook for Software Architects. I wanted convince agile developers that emergent design doesn't guarantee good software architecture. And often, you need to pay extra attention to architecture, especially if you are working on a large project. I cannot find in the literature a precise distinction between Software Architecture and Software Design. If you're an architect, or at all interested in architecture, this book is essential reading. Software Architecture in Practice. After 10 years, the most influential software architecture book, Software Architecture in Practice, has released a new edition. Software Architecture in practice - eBay Design - by Randy Shoup. [6] Bass, L., Clements, P., and Kazman, R.

Download more ebooks:
SQL Performance Explained (vol. 1: Basic Indexing) book